Design Intent + +Destruction of inputs creates wider cascades than destruction of finished goods. + +A timber yard fire affects construction, transport, agriculture, military logistics, and workshop recovery simultaneously. The participant should learn to think in dependencies rather than headlines. + +This scenario validates: + +- upstream choke-point logic +- multi-sector shortage propagation +- scenario compounding with 0001 +- route-constrained NEGOTIVM decisions +- state demand distortion +- time-sensitive arbitrage + +--- + +## 1. Historical Basis + +Roman Italy required sustained timber flows for: + +- construction +- carts and wheels +- agricultural implements +- scaffolding +- river and coastal craft components +- military logistics +- fuel and charcoal production + +Contractor yards and timber depots plausibly stored seasoned stock for downstream use or onward shipment. + +This scenario is an analogue model, not a claim of a specific recorded Capuan incident. + +Confidence: Medium +Sources: Roman logistics scholarship; transport studies; timber demand in antiquity. + +--- + +## 4. Immediate Effects (0–7 days) + +| Effect | Direction | +|---|---| +| available timber stock | down | +| carpentry throughput | down | +| wheelwright capacity | down | +| cart repair speed | down | +| urgent buyers | up | +| speculation | up | +| rumor volume | up | + +--- + +## 7. Secondary Effects (7–30 days) + +| Effect | Direction | +|---|---| +| timber prices in Capua | up | +| transport rates | up | +| farm implement delays | up | +| building delays | up | +| substitute imports | up | +| theft risk for lumber | up | +| contractor credit stress | up | +| state requisition pressure | possible | + +--- + +## 8. Tertiary Effects (30+ days) + +| Effect | Direction | +|---|---| +| regional forest extraction | up | +| road congestion | up | +| poor-quality substitutes used | possible | +| migration of craftsmen | possible | +| durable merchant contracts | possible | +| local political realignment | possible | + +--- + +## 9. Merchant Venture Logic (Ostia -> Capua) + +Merchant departs Ostia before Capua fully reprices. + +### Candidate Cargo Ventures + +| Cargo | Thesis | +|---|---| +| nails / fasteners | rebuild demand | +| bronze tools | carpentry recovery | +| iron tools | substitute demand | +| rope | hauling operations | +| pitch / tar | treatment and repair | +| wheel hardware | transport bottleneck relief | +| food staples | urgent crews and displaced labor | + +### Separate Financial Opportunities (Non-Cargo) + +These are distinct NEGOTIA and should not be modeled as cargo: + +| Action | Thesis | +|---|---| +| short-term lending | distressed contractor liquidity | +| advance purchase contracts | lock future timber supply | +| debt claim acquisition | buy impaired obligations cheaply | +| partnership finance | fund rebuild for future share | + +--- + +## 10. Linked Scenario Logic (with 0001) + +If SCENARIO-MERCHANT-0001 occurred recently: + +- fewer bronze tools available regionally +- timber processing slower +- rebuild costs higher +- cart shortages worsen transport delays +- price spikes intensify + +Scenarios should compound rather than exist in isolation. + +--- + +## 11.
